Well the motor is back in the Monte Carlo as of the end of April.I ran it for the first time this year at Cecil County Dragway back on June 30th...we had a half way cool-temp night for a change.It ran like it did last year...which is a good thing.I've seen motors rebuilt & slow up sometimes.I wanted at least to go mid 10's on motor & mid 9's on spray like last year,and it did!
First pass was a [email protected] with a 1.53 sixty ft. (shift 6800)
Second pass was a [email protected] with a 1.55 sixty ft (shifted late 2nd & 3rd)
Third pass was a [email protected] with a 1.55 sixty ft (shifted late 2nd & 3rd)
If I shift around 6800 it runs best,or so it seems to like it.If I shift around 7000-7100 it slows up.I might try shifting 6400-6600 to see how it likes that.Still learning what this car likes.The closer to idle I leave,the better it 60 fts too....1500 or so...up at 2000 slows it up.
I sprayed it on the last pass with a 200 shot dead out of the whole..it spun.
Ran a [email protected] with a 1.53 sixty ft.
Had a good time.Now waiting for another cooler night to go back.

What gears and if you don't mind, how much rear tire pressure you running??
 
It's a pump gas 498 that made 670 HP at the crank.Took a 454 block,bored .070" over & added a 4.250" crank in place of the factory stroke at 4.000"
I still use my GM cast iron square port closed chambered heads.It has a custom Ross piston in it,that makes 10.2to1 compression.The heads are bowl ported,and the intake ports aren't ported,just gasket matched to a heavily ported Team-G intake with the runners extended up under the carb.The exhaust ports are smoothed,but not ported.
I run a 4.10 gear in it.Those are HOOSIER drag radials.They seem to like 17-18 lbs hot,haven't tried them lower,but up at 20lbs hot it spun.I have a Cold Fusion fogger on it with the 200 shot jets.
The car weighs 3785 with me & a half tank of gas.
